Spotting Fakes: A Consumer's Guide

Navigating the market can be tricky these days. With increasing numbers of copyright products, it's more important than ever for consumers to cultivate their ability in spotting fakes. A casual approach can lead to monetary damage, as well as obtaining products that are unsafe.

  • A key strategy is to conduct your research. Before purchasing a transaction, look into the reputation of the merchant. Check online feedback and contrast prices from multiple sources.
  • Offer close scrutiny to the product itself. Examine it for any deficiencies in construction. Fake items often have subpar materials and execution.
  • Don't be swayed by unreasonably low prices. If it seems too good to be true, it probably is. Con artists often employ inflated discounts to lure in unsuspecting buyers.

Remember that caution is your best defense against falling victim to counterfeits. By following these simple suggestions, you can ensure more informed purchases.
